Albion Online talks about its novel and community feedback patch

    
4

As the year wraps up, Albion Online continues to handle several irons in its alpha fire. One of these is release of a community feedback patch in which the team addressed several areas that players have deemed important. These include improvements to the frame system and destiny board, better spawn rates for tier 5 mobs and resources, and more loot for treasure hunting and hellgate plundering.

The team also sat down to chat with author Peter Newman, the man who is writing the first tie-in novel that seeks to expand the lore of Albion Online’s world. The novel will be released in the first part of 2016, and you can listen to the 11-minute interview about it after the break.
